Beyond CRM: How AI and Automation Elevate Your Customer Data Strategy
For most businesses, a Customer Relationship Management (CRM) system is the foundational layer of their sales, marketing, and service operations. It’s where customer interactions live, where deals are tracked, and where the future of your pipeline is visualized. Yet, for all its promise, many organizations find their CRM acting more like a static data repository than a dynamic engine for growth. This often leads to underutilized data, missed opportunities, and a frustrating amount of manual effort, diminishing the very scalability and efficiency it was meant to provide.
The problem isn’t always with the CRM itself, but with how it’s integrated—or not integrated—into the broader operational ecosystem. Data entry remains a manual burden, leading to inconsistencies and errors. Information gets siloed in disparate systems, preventing a unified customer view. Crucial insights remain buried, simply because the sheer volume of data makes manual analysis impractical. These inefficiencies don’t just consume valuable employee time; they directly impact revenue, customer satisfaction, and the ability to make data-driven strategic decisions.
Transforming Data from Storage to Strategic Asset with AI
This is where the transformative power of AI steps in. Imagine a CRM that doesn’t just store data, but actively enriches it, analyzes it, and offers proactive recommendations. AI moves your customer data from a passive historical record to an active, predictive asset. It can parse unstructured data from emails, call transcripts, and social media, extracting sentiment, identifying key topics, and flagging potential opportunities or risks that a human might miss.
AI’s capabilities extend far beyond simple analytics. It can automate the process of data hygiene, identifying and merging duplicate records, correcting inconsistencies, and even enriching contact profiles with publicly available information. This ensures your CRM maintains a “Single Source of Truth,” reducing human error and providing a reliable foundation for all your customer-facing activities. Consider AI-powered lead scoring, which uses sophisticated algorithms to predict the likelihood of a conversion, allowing your sales team to prioritize their efforts on the most promising prospects. Or AI-driven content recommendations, personalizing communication based on a customer’s historical interactions and stated preferences.
By leveraging AI, your CRM becomes a more intelligent partner. It helps you understand not just who your customers are, but what they need, what their pain points are, and how best to engage with them, all in real time. This level of insight empowers your teams to deliver highly personalized experiences, forge stronger relationships, and ultimately, drive higher conversion rates and customer loyalty.
Automation: The Orchestrator of Intelligent Customer Journeys
While AI provides the intelligence, automation acts as the orchestrator, ensuring that this intelligence is put into action seamlessly across all your business systems. Traditional CRMs often require manual data transfer or repetitive tasks to keep information flowing between sales, marketing, support, and back-office operations. This is a breeding ground for errors and inefficiency.
Automation solutions, often powered by platforms like Make.com, bridge these gaps. They connect your CRM to dozens of other SaaS applications – marketing automation platforms, project management tools, communication systems, and even internal databases. This connectivity enables sophisticated, multi-step workflows that execute automatically based on predefined triggers. For instance, when a deal status changes in your CRM, automation can instantly trigger a personalized email campaign, create a new task in your project management system, update a Slack channel, and even generate a proposal document via PandaDoc, all without human intervention.
This level of integration and automation reduces low-value, repetitive work for your high-value employees, freeing them to focus on strategic tasks that require human creativity and judgment. It eliminates human error, ensures timely follow-ups, and guarantees that every customer interaction is consistent and aligned with your brand standards. The result is a hyper-efficient, proactive operational environment where your customer data is not just stored, but actively worked, enriching every stage of the customer journey and supporting unprecedented scalability.
